Dr. Leonard G. Horowitz, a Harvard-trained researcher, has formally requested an investigation into the origins of COVID-19 and the technologies employed in the pandemic response, including vaccine delivery systems. The legal notice, directed to key U.S. health and legal officials, raises questions about the role of gain-of-function research in the virus's emergence and the safety of novel vaccine technologies.
The notice highlights concerns over the use of mRNA platforms and hydrogel components in vaccines, suggesting a possible link to adverse health effects. Dr. Horowitz calls for a science-based review of these technologies and the regulatory processes governing them, emphasizing the importance of public transparency and accountability in addressing these critical health issues.
This call to action underscores the ongoing debate over the origins of COVID-19 and the safety of the technologies developed to combat it, with potential implications for public health policy and the future of vaccine development.
